If you go with the Mars 600's...Get 2 of them for a 4x4 room. They don't preform quite to the level of other LED's, but the Mars are cheap, just get more.They DO work, you just need enough of them.
I had 2 400's in a 2x2.5 room(180 watts each for 360 watts), That was enough, but not too much.

Rule of thumb for lighting is at least 40 to 50 watts per square foot. Watts coming from the wall watts.

OTHERWISE go HID. Mars and other cheap led manifactures use epiled 5 w diodes......which are actually less efficient than a good old 1000w HPS bulb.
